HI ..
I HAVE TWO IMPORTANT QUESTIONS.
1). i got nominated from AINP applied to the federal in oct. 2012 got AOR in the 1st week of dec. 2012 . when should I expect my medical ? how much time cpp-ottawa is taking to give the PR visa .
2). I applied under AINP but the company for which I was working moved me to BC on permanent basis , and I changed my address in CRA as well as CIC application status . Does that effect my application ?
Kindly share your experiences if you've one. Your replies will be highly appreciated.

Hi snoor1987,
I believe you should have already got your Medical Request by this time...but because of this holidays season, we may expect a bit delay in the progress....that's quite common. But, no need to worry at all. Coming to next thing, CPP Ottawa processing time line is 11 months from the date of your AOR...I mean to get your PR (if everything goes fine in terms of your background check, medicals and all).
I have no idea about your second question...sorry.
